Getting an operations research major is all about getting the required skills and knowledge to find ways to solve problems in all sorts of industries. These program are designed to focus on using complex mathematical models to solve complicated problems. The major provides detailed instruction in the applications of judgment and statistical tests, resource allocation theory, control theory, advanced multivariate analysis, and mathematical modeling. After majoring in operations research, you can pursue a career as a statistician, budget analyst, economist, computer scientist, mathematician, management consultant, or as a computer system analyst.
